Technical Field

[0001] This utility model relates to the field of lighting technology, and in particular to a ceiling light. Background Technology

[0002] A ceiling light is a type of lighting fixture. As the name suggests, it is called a ceiling light because the top of the fixture is relatively flat, and the bottom of the fixture can be completely attached to the flat surface of the ceiling during installation.

[0003] Ceiling lights typically consist of a lamp holder, a lamp panel within the lamp holder, and a lampshade connected to the lamp holder. The lamp panel has several LED chips or LED strips, and the lampshade is detachably connected to the lamp holder. Currently, ceiling lights are shipped with the lampshade already installed on the lamp holder. Therefore, when installing a ceiling light, users need to first remove the lampshade from the lamp holder, then fix the lamp holder to the ceiling surface with screws, and finally reinstall the lampshade onto the lamp holder.

[0004] Existing lampshades are generally assembled with lamp holders using a snap-fit ​​structure. Therefore, when installing ceiling lights, the snap-fit ​​assembly makes it difficult to disassemble the lampshade and adds to the installation steps, making the installation process more complicated. Utility Model Content

[0005] The purpose of this utility model is to overcome the defects of the prior art. This utility model provides a ceiling light with locking protrusions or connecting hooks on both sides of the lamp holder. The locking protrusions or connecting hooks on both sides are asymmetrically arranged. The lampshade is installed in reverse on the lamp holder when it leaves the factory, and the lampshade is not installed on the lamp holder, which facilitates the installation of the ceiling light.

[0006] The technical solution of this utility model is as follows: A ceiling light includes a lamp holder, a lamp plate disposed within the lamp holder, and a lamp cover. The lamp plate is provided with LED beads or LED strips. The lamp cover is detachably connected to the lamp holder. One of the lamp holder and the lamp cover has a first locking protrusion and a second locking protrusion on both sides, and the other has a first connecting hook and a second connecting hook on both sides. There is at least one first locking protrusion and a first connecting hook, and at least two second locking protrusions and second connecting hooks. The first locking protrusion and the second locking protrusion are staggered. When the first connecting hook is engaged with the corresponding first locking protrusion and the second connecting hook is engaged with the corresponding second locking protrusion, the lamp cover and the lamp holder are snapped together. When the first connecting hook and the second locking protrusion are on the same side, and when the second connecting hook and the first locking protrusion are on the same side, the lamp cover and the lamp holder are separate.

[0007] By adopting the above technical solution, the first and second locking protrusions are offset and asymmetrically arranged. When the ceiling light leaves the factory, the lampshade is not connected to the lamp holder, and the direction in which the lampshade is placed on the lamp holder is different from the direction after it is installed on the lamp holder. The first connecting hook is located on one side of the second locking protrusion, and the second connecting hook is located on one side of the first locking protrusion, so that the connecting hooks cannot cooperate with the locking protrusions on the same side. In this way, when the user receives the ceiling light, there is no need to remove the lampshade. The lampshade can be directly removed from the lamp holder. After the lamp holder is installed on the ceiling, the lampshade is then installed on the lamp holder. The first connecting hook is on the same side as the first locking protrusion, and the second connecting hook is on the same side as the second locking protrusion. The first connecting hook is attached to the first locking protrusion, and the second connecting hook is attached to the second locking protrusion, completing the installation of the ceiling light more conveniently and quickly.

[0008] A further feature of this invention is that the lamp holder contains a mounting base, the lamp plate is hinged to the mounting base and can be rotated relative to the mounting base, and the lamp holder also contains a locking element for locking the lamp plate.

[0009] With the above-mentioned further configuration, the lamp panel can rotate relative to the mounting base, allowing for the installation of large-area lamp panels and enabling the lamp panel to open at a large angle, facilitating the maintenance and installation of other internal structures.

[0010] A further feature of this invention is that the lamp panel is provided with an unlocking groove, the locking member is rotatably disposed within the lamp holder, and the locking member is provided with a locking block. When the locking block is located within the unlocking groove, the lamp panel can rotate relative to the lamp holder. When the locking block and the unlocking groove are misaligned, the rotation of the lamp panel can be restricted.

[0011] With the above-mentioned further settings, the operation is convenient and quick, and the locking and unlocking of the light panel can be achieved quickly. After locking, the light panel structure is firm, and after the ceiling light is installed on the ceiling, the light panel will not fall and affect its use. In addition, the setting of the locking block also makes it easy to operate the locking mechanism.

[0012] A further feature of this invention is that it includes a decorative cover located on the outer periphery of the lampshade and detachably connected to the lampshade. One of the lampshade and the decorative cover is provided with a third connecting hook, and the other is provided with a corresponding connecting slot. Several third connecting hooks are provided along the circumference of the lampshade or the decorative cover, and each third connecting hook is hooked into the corresponding connecting slot to realize the connection between the decorative cover and the lampshade.

[0013] The above-mentioned further design enhances the overall aesthetics of the ceiling light, and the combination of hooks and latches facilitates the assembly and disassembly of the lampshade and decorative cover.

[0014] A further feature of this invention is that one of the lamp holder and the lamp cover has a third locking protrusion at both ends, and the other has a fourth connecting hook that cooperates with the third locking protrusion at both ends. The two third locking protrusions are offset from the central axis of the lamp holder or the lamp cover and are arranged opposite each other. The two fourth connecting hooks are offset from the central axis of the lamp cover or the lamp holder and are arranged opposite each other.

[0015] The above-mentioned further design enhances the stability between the lamp holder and the lamp cover. Furthermore, the positioning of the third locking protrusion and the fourth connecting hook eliminates the need to disassemble the lamp cover and lamp holder before installing the ceiling light, making installation more convenient and quick.

[0016] Further features of this invention include: the first locking protrusion and the second locking protrusion are respectively located on both sides of the lamp holder; the third locking protrusion is located at both ends of the lamp holder; the first connecting hook and the second connecting hook are respectively located on both sides of the lamp cover; the fourth connecting hook is located at both ends of the lamp cover; and a through groove is provided on the lower end face of the lamp holder corresponding to the position of each locking protrusion.

[0017] The above-mentioned further design facilitates the disassembly of the lampshade and lamp holder. By inserting an external tool into the through groove and moving the connecting hook, the connecting hook can be elastically deformed and disengaged from the locking boss, thus completing the disassembly.

[0018] A further feature of this invention is that the lamp holder has a mounting groove, the mounting groove contains a sealing element, and when the lamp cover is placed on the lamp holder, the lower end face of the lamp cover presses against the sealing element.

[0019] The above-mentioned further design prevents mosquitoes from entering the lamp holder through gaps and affecting its performance.

[0020] A further feature of this invention is as follows: the lamp holder is provided with an installation shaft and support shafts located at both ends of the installation shaft. The locking member is rotatably mounted on the installation shaft. The installation shaft and support shaft are arranged opposite to the mounting base. When the lamp panel is locked, the other side of the lamp panel rests on the support shaft. A limiting plate is provided between the two support shafts and the installation shaft. A limiting block is provided on the outer wall of the locking member. The limiting block cooperates with the two limiting plates to limit the rotation angle of the locking member.

[0021] With the above-mentioned further design, the support shaft can act as a support for the light panel during normal use, making its structure stable. The installation shaft ensures that the structure is stable when the locking component rotates. The locking component can also be installed on the installation shaft with screws to prevent it from detaching from the installation shaft, but without hindering its rotation. This makes the locking of the light panel more secure. The limit block can limit the rotation angle of the locking component to prevent it from rotating too much and affecting the unlocking or locking effect. Attached Figure Description

[0037] The lamp holder 1 and the lampshade 3 each have a third locking protrusion 13 at both ends, and the other lamp has a fourth connecting hook 33 at both ends that mates with the third locking protrusion 13. The two third locking protrusions 13 are offset from the central axis of the lamp holder 1 or the lampshade 3 and are opposite to each other. The two fourth connecting hooks 33 are also offset from the central axis of the lampshade 3 or the lamp holder 1. The third locking protrusions and fourth connecting hooks are not positioned in the middle of the lamp holder and the lampshade, so that when the lampshade is shipped from the factory, the third locking protrusions and fourth connecting hooks are misaligned. During installation, the lampshade is rotated 180°, the fourth connecting hooks align with the third locking protrusions, and hook onto the third locking protrusions to complete the installation of the lampshade and the lamp holder, further improving the firmness between the lamp holder 1 and the lampshade 3. The positioning of the third locking protrusion 13 and the fourth connecting hook 33 makes it easier and faster to install the ceiling light without disassembling the lampshade 3 and the lamp holder 1 before installation. In this embodiment, the first locking protrusion 11 and the second locking protrusion 12 are respectively located on both sides of the lamp holder 1, the third locking protrusion 13 is located at both ends of the lamp holder 1, the first connecting hook 31 and the second connecting hook 32 are respectively located on both sides of the lampshade 3, and the fourth connecting hook 33 is located at both ends of the lampshade 3. The lower end of the lamp holder 1 is provided with a through groove 14 corresponding to the position of each locking protrusion to facilitate the disassembly of the lampshade 3 and the lamp holder 1. By inserting an external tool into the through groove 14 and moving the connecting hook, the connecting hook can be elastically deformed and disengaged from the locking protrusion, thus completing the disassembly.
